[QUOTE=Black Milano;17666660]GTR 2 is probably the best simulation, NFS:Most Wanted is one of my favorite arcades and the new NFS:Shift is in my opinion the best of both worlds.[/QUOTE]
GTR series surely are the "simulation-oriented" games with the most content, i.e. cars, tracks and a campaign.
But as far as realism goes, they're still a joke in comparison to [I]Live for Speed[/I], or maybe [I]RFactor[/I].
However, I'd recommend neither of those if you're not really into sim-racing.
And you can probably forget about all of the above if you don't have a wheel.
If you want something that's fun in the first place, you should go with [I]GRID[/I] or NfS Shift, though I haven't tried the latter.
